призе́мистый — meaning in English

prizemistyy

Russian → English · translate English → Russian instead

English meaning

  • squat adj Short and thick-set; low and broad rather than tall.
  • stubby adjective Short and thick.

Senses

призе́мистый is used for these senses in English:

  • squat Relatively short or low, and thick or broad.
  • stubby Like a stub; short, especially cut short, thick and stiff; stunted; stubbed.

squat — full definition

  1. adj Short and thick-set; low and broad rather than tall.
  2. verb To crouch down close to the ground by bending the knees.
  3. verb To do a strength exercise where you bend your knees and lower your body, often with weight on your shoulders.
  4. verb To live in or occupy a building or land without owning it or having permission.
  5. noun Informal: nothing at all.
